Battle to save weakened whale lost in the Seine

French authorities are tracking a Beluga whale that strayed into the Seine River. Picture: Francois Mori/AP

French environmentalists were hoping to feed a catch of herring to a worryingly thin Beluga whale that has strayed far from its Arctic habitat into France’s Seine River.

They fear that the ethereal white mammal is slowly starving in the waterway that flows through Paris and beyond.
